What you have there is normal behaviour with paragraphs that wrap around objects. You have bulleted paragraphs, with first line indents & tabs and Word is respecting those settings, even when the paragraphs have to start way to the right of the margins because of the inserted object. The second & subsequent lines go back as far as they can because they haven't reached their own indents. Not entirely consistent, I agree. Although you could work around this by playing around with the paragraph indents & tabs, I doubt you'd even get a result that everyone would agree on. If you want a more 'sensible' layout, the simple solution is to move the picture to the other side of the page.
